<p><strong>Mumbai</strong> &#8211; Adani Enterprises achieved a major financial milestone as its $2.8 billion rights issue closed oversubscribed, marking a strong return of market confidence in one of India’s most influential conglomerates.</p>



<p>The successful subscription reflects renewed trust from investors, both domestic and global, in the group’s long-term growth vision and expanding infrastructure footprint.</p>



<p>The issue attracted bids for nearly 150 million shares against the 138.5 million offered, showcasing healthy participation across investor categories.</p>



<p>Promoters fully subscribed to their portion, while public investors oversubscribed their allocation by a remarkable margin, reinforcing the company’s positive momentum.</p>



<p>This capital raise is the group’s largest since facing scrutiny in 2023, and its success showcases the resilience of the Adani business model.</p>



<p>Market analysts say the strong response highlights the company’s ability to navigate challenges while maintaining its focus on high-growth sectors.</p>



<p>The rights issue, priced attractively at 1,800 rupees per share, offered eligible shareholders three shares for every 25 held.</p>



<p>This structure gave long-term investors a compelling opportunity to deepen their holdings in a company that remains central to India’s infrastructure and energy transition.</p>



<p>Adani Enterprises announced that the funds raised will be strategically deployed to reduce debt and support capital expenditure.</p>



<p>This includes repayment of shareholder loans, which will further strengthen the company’s balance sheet and enhance financial stability.</p>
